About the Department

The Wolfson School of Mechanical, Electrical and Manufacturing Engineering at Loughborough University is one of the largest and most successful engineering schools in the UK, consistently ranked among the top ten for our disciplines. We combine world-leading research with an outstanding student experience, underpinned by long-standing partnerships with industry leaders. Our collaborative and ambitious culture supports colleagues to excel across research, teaching and enterprise in support of the University Strategy, Creating Better Futures. Together.

The School wishes to appoint a Senior Lecturer/Lecturer in Embedded Systems and Intelligent Computing to strengthen its research and teaching in future technologies. Our focus is on Embedded Systems, Digital Electronics, Computer Architecture, Cybersecurity, and Edge Artificial Intelligence rather than device fabrication. We welcome applications from candidates working across Embedded Systems and Intelligent Computing, and the translation and industrial adoption of quantum technologies.

The successful candidate will build on the Schools capability in digital electronics, RF engineering, computer architecture, and cybersecurity, with significant scope for interdisciplinary collaboration across the University. The appointee will contribute to teaching undergraduate and postgraduate programmes and will develop specialist teaching in emerging engineering technologies available as options to students across other disciplines. This post forms part of the Schools long-term strategic investment in future and emerging engineering technologies.

About You

You will have a PhD or equivalent research experience in Embedded Systems, Digital Electronics, Cybersecurity, Edge Artificial Intelligence, or a closely related field. Expertise in the design, implementation, and security of embedded systems is essential. You will have a track record of research excellence, with publications in leading journals and a trajectory towards international recognition. Experience in translating research into real-world applications or collaboration with industry partners is particularly welcomed.
